Justin Bieber Protests Critics Of Hailey’s Every Move

Justin Bieber protests the constant wave of public criticism directed at his wife, Hailey Bieber, in a quiet yet deliberate show of support. On Thursday, the pop star “liked” a fan-made Instagram post defending Hailey from internet trolls who claim she has no real job. The post featured the model in a luxurious Saint Laurent fur coat, alongside a text that read, “Jobless people tearing Hailey Bieber apart.”

Without directly commenting, Justin also shared the photo of his wife in a recent captionless photo dump on his own profile. The move comes as part of his ongoing effort to shield Hailey from mounting online hate, especially during a period filled with renewed scrutiny.

Online Trolls Intensify Attacks

In recent weeks, Hailey has once again found herself at the center of social media criticism. Despite being a successful entrepreneur and model, many continue to dissect her every move. These comments often accuse her of copying, shading, or competing with Justin’s ex, Selena Gomez.

This dynamic dates back to 2015, when rumors of Justin and Hailey’s relationship first surfaced. At the time, the singer was still involved in an on-and-off romance with Gomez, which had begun in 2010. When Justin and Selena officially broke up in 2018, he proposed to Hailey soon after, and the couple married later that year.

Justin Bieber Protests With Subtle Signals

Throughout their relationship, Justin Bieber protests the constant comparisons between his wife and his ex. Despite Hailey’s attempts to avoid drama, she often finds herself the target of toxic commentary. Supporters of Gomez have long accused her of imitating or criticizing the Rare Beauty founder through social media behavior.

Yet, even Gomez has intervened to shut down the hate. In 2023, she used her Instagram platform to urge fans to stop harassing Hailey, revealing that the two had discussed putting an end to the public narrative surrounding their supposed feud. Hailey later confirmed that she and Gomez had opened a dialogue to move forward and resolve the lingering tension.

Ongoing Rumors And Public Scrutiny

Even as Hailey tried to rise above the noise, controversy continued. Most recently, she denied accusations of liking a TikTok post mocking Gomez and her fiancé, Benny Blanco. Critics seized on the alleged interaction, attempting to revive old feuds and create new ones.

Meanwhile, concerns about the state of Hailey and Justin’s marriage have persisted. Observers have speculated about their relationship for years, often interpreting every photo or social media post as evidence of trouble. Some even suggest the couple is on the verge of splitting.

Couple Reportedly Plans Fresh Start Abroad

Reports now claim the couple is considering a major change. According to the US Sun, Justin and Hailey are looking to purchase a home in Europe, away from Los Angeles. The move would allow them to reset their lives and focus on family following the birth of their son, Jack Blues, in August.

Sources say Hailey has been particularly worried about Justin’s well-being, especially following reports of his recent erratic behavior. As Justin Bieber protests the toxic chatter online, he also seems focused on reconnecting with his wife and stepping away from the constant spotlight.

Herbert Bauernebel

Herbert Bauernebel has been reporting from New York since 1999 and currently works for Bild.de, OE24 TV, and US Live. He also runs the news portal AmerikaReport.de. Bauernebel has covered nearly all major US events of the past quarter-century, including 9/11, Hurricane Katrina, Barack Obama’s election, Donald Trump’s surprise victory, the pandemic, last year’s election showdown, as well as natural disasters such as hurricanes and oil spills. He has also reported firsthand on international events, including the Asian tsunami, the Haiti earthquake, and the Fukushima disaster. He lives in Brooklyn with his family and holds degrees in communication and political science from the University of Vienna. Bauernebel is the author of a book about his experiences on 9/11, And the Air Was Full of Ash: 9/11 – The Day That Changed My Life.
